American India Foundation (AIF) is a foundation based in New York, New York, dedicated to advancing the well-being of underserved communities, particularly focusing on women, children, and youth. Located at 211 E 43rd St Ste. 1900, the organization serves as a conduit for resources and support to address social challenges faced by vulnerable populations. AIF’s efforts are rooted in fostering sustainable development and empowerment through strategic partnerships and community engagement.
The foundation operates by mobilizing philanthropic capital and volunteer support to implement programs that improve access to education, healthcare, and livelihood opportunities.
